NEW YORK -- The Boston Red Sox are pulling Walker Buehler from their rotation and sending the struggling right-hander to the bullpen.
"It's going to be his new role," manager Alex Cora said Friday before the Red Sox continued a four-game series with the Yankees . "We'll figure out how it goes, maybe one inning, multiple innings. Whatever it is, we don't know yet."
Buehler's next scheduled start would have been the opener of a four-game series in Baltimore on Monday. The Red Sox did not immediately announce who would take his turn. Right-hander Richard Fitts , currently with the Red Sox, and left-hander Kyle Harrison, who is at Triple A after being acquired in the Rafael Devers trade, are options.
